Balance is the body’s ability to maintain its center of mass over its base of support. This can be influenced by several factors, including muscle strength, flexibility, and proprioception, which is the awareness of our body’s position in space. Coordination, on the other hand, is the smooth and efficient functioning of different body parts, allowing for the graceful execution of movements. Both balance and coordination are integral to performing daily activities safely, whether it is walking, exercising, or engaging in sports.
One of the primary challenges in improving balance and coordination is the gradual decline that occurs with age or due to injuries. When our balance starts to wane, the risk of falls significantly increases, which can lead to serious consequences such as fractures or head injuries.
